Is there a way back for us?
The spread is kind about the future and unconvinced about the past.
The Six of Cups is the card of memory and of the past being handed to you like a bouquet; reversed, it says the looking back has become the problem rather than the comfort. The Eight of Swords underneath is a figure bound among swords that do not actually block the way — a restriction believed rather than real, which is what a story about «only this person» usually is. Then the Star, upright, at the end: the card that comes after everything difficult and restores what was drained. The spread does not promise a return to what was. It says the hope is real and it points somewhere ahead rather than behind.
